2011-03-09 3 views
0

Я занимаюсь некоторыми исследованиями по вопросу о возможности проекта Sharepoint, который появился на нашем пути. В основном, мы стараемся поддерживать синхронизацию пользователей на сайте SP и внешней системе. У нас нет предыдущего опыта работы с SP, хотя мы знакомы с ASP.net.Создать Sharepoint Пользователи из webservices

Итак, нам нужна возможность создавать пользователей и устанавливать пользовательскую роль пользователей SP через веб-службы. Я прочитал, что у SP нет собственных пользователей, и они поступают из AD или SQL DB и т. Д. И методы API, которые я видел в веб-службе UserGroup, показывают, что я не могу делать то, что ищу. Например. Я не могу создать пользователя с заданным именем пользователя и паролем в SP, поверх WS. Это правильно?

Если да, значит ли это, что мы должны напрямую кодировать SQL-базу данных, содержащую таблицы членства ASPNET? Или есть сторонний компонент, который мы можем развернуть на хосте SP, который предоставит нам необходимые функции управления пользователями?

ответ

1

Вы верны. Сам SharePoint не управляет аутентификацией; вам понадобится другой метод. Например: NTLM, LDAP, база данных или сторонняя организация. Больше информации здесь: http://technet.microsoft.com/en-us/library/cc262350.aspx.

Как только вы сможете аутентифицировать пользователей, вы затем используете веб-службы SharePoint, чтобы предоставить пользователям право на контент в SharePoint.

+0

Спасибо, что эта модель, основанная на требованиях, кажется, это путь. – Sameera

1

Могу ли я this вас в пути?

+0

Пила этот трюк тоже. Но, по-прежнему, я пока не могу создать пользователя с конкретным паролем. – Sameera

Смежные вопросы